Oregon Statutes - Chapter 677 - Regulation of Medicine, Podiatry and Acupuncture - Section 677.491 - Reporting toy-related injury or death; rules.

(1) Whenever any physician determines or reasonably suspects the injury or death of a person to be toy-related, the physician shall, in accordance with rules adopted under subsection (5) of this section, report the physician’s findings to the Director of Human Services.

(2) The director of any hospital, health care facility, health maintenance organization, public health center, medical center or emergency medical treatment facility where any physician has made a determination or has a reasonable suspicion under subsection (1) of this section as to whether an injury or death is toy-related, shall, in accordance with the rules adopted under subsection (5) of this section, report that physician’s findings to the Director of Human Services.

(3) The Director of Human Services shall review, organize and keep a record of the information set forth in the reports of toy-related injuries and deaths submitted by physicians under this section. The director, on a regular basis, shall make the information recorded under this section available to the United States Consumer Product Safety Commission for inclusion in its Injury or Potential Injury Incident Data Base. The information so recorded shall also be made available to the public for a fee determined by the director.

(4) If the Director of Human Services determines that a specific toy or item poses an immediate danger or potential threat to the safety of the citizens of this state, the director shall immediately issue a public notice warning the public, retail sellers and distributors of the director’s findings and recommendations concerning that toy or item.

(5) The Director of Human Services shall adopt rules to implement this section. [1991 c.325 §1]

Note: 677.491 was enacted into law by the Legislative Assembly but was not added to or made a part of ORS chapter 677 by legislative action. See Preface to Oregon Revised Statutes for further explanation.
